di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index 6827ea4d8e8c95d6832d8560a8669f5033f57b89..1773b223046c2109a17178bd13191f50cd305646 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-3,10 +3,12 @@ build:
   stage: build
   services:
     - docker:24.0-dind
+  variables:
+    IMAGE_TAG: $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_SLUG
   script:
     - docker login -u $CI_REGISTRY_USER -p $CI_REGISTRY_PASSWORD $CI_REGISTRY
     - docker build -t $CI_COMMIT_BRANCH.$CI_COMMIT_TIMESTAMP .
-    - docker push $CI_REGISTRY/geant-devops/sonarqube-scripts:${CI_COMMIT_BRANCH}.${CI_COMMIT_TIMESTAMP}
+    - docker push $IMAGE_TAG
     #- docker run my-docker-image /script/to/run/tests
   tags:
     - sonarqube